DEVONMAN wrote:
ian.stewart wrote:One thing that is often omitted when putting the engine back together, it the steel thrower ring this is an important and effective way of getting oil onto the timing gears
I think the thrower was only used in early engines with cam driven mechanical fuel pumps and rope front seals. As far as I recall, the thrower will foul on the internal eyebrow over the seal on later rubber oil seal type front covers.

Done this mod a few years ago to try and prevent the excessive wear I was getting on the cam gear. However it didn't make a blind bit of difference. Turns out the problem was knackered cam bearings.
